linux下面用命令执行.sh文件有两种方法:

一、直接./加上文件名.sh,如运行hello.sh为./hello.sh【hello.sh必须有x权限】

二、直接sh 加上文件名.sh,如运行hello.sh为sh hello.sh【hello.sh可以没有x权限】

方法一:当前目录执行.sh文件

【步骤一】cd到.sh文件所在目录

【步骤二】给.sh文件添加x执行权限

比如以hello.sh文件为例,终端执行以下命令:

chmod u+x hello.sh

【步骤三】./执行.sh文件

比如以hello.sh文件为例,终端执行以下命令,即可执行hello.sh文件

./hello.sh

【步骤二(2)】sh 执行.sh文件

以hello.sh文件为例,sh hello.sh即可执行hello.sh文件。

sh hello.sh

方法二:绝对路径执行.sh文件

下面三种方法都可以:

 1          ./home/test/shell/hello.sh2          /home/test/shell/hello.sh3         sh /home/test/shell/hello.sh

注意事项

用“./”加文件名.sh执行时,必须给.sh文件加x执行权限。

linux下如何运行.sh脚本相关推荐

  1. linux启动sh文件命令,Linux下如何写 .sh 脚本启动 项目

    Linux下如何写 .sh 脚本启动 项目 创建文件   mealcoupon.sh 内容如下: #!/bin/bash #这里可替换为你自己的执行程序,其他代码无需更改 APP_NAME=xhqy_ ...

  2. Linux下如何运行.sh文件

    在Linux系统下运行.sh文件有两种方法, 比如在~/桌面/LoveDA-master/Semantic_Segmentation/scripts目录下有个predict_test.sh文件 第一种 ...

  3. linux下编辑aacc.sh脚本命令,Shell命令实战详解

    1.按照指定的某段路径,进行数据拷贝. =>head Assembly.txt/ifs1/ST_ENV/USER/liyiyuan/liushanlin/1KITE_1_2/110817_I80 ...

  4. linux下双击执行.sh脚本文件

    1.当写好一个.sh脚本文件后,给他赋予执行权限后,双击的时候,默认是以文本编辑器打开的,无法运行该脚本文件. 2.打开终端. 3.输入如下命令,需要联网: sudo apt install dcon ...

  5. Linux系统双击运行sh脚本

    第一步 创建桌面文件:myapp.desktop,新建文件,后缀名改为.desktop,编辑内容: [Desktop Entry] Name = myapp Exec = /home/liud/桌面/ ...

  6. mac下如何运行sh脚本文件

    一.编辑一个 .sh 脚本文件 假设我的脚本文件名为 nice.sh 以下讲解如何运行 nice.sh 二.给shell脚本赋权限 有三种方法 # 方法一 chmod a+x nice.sh# 方法二 ...

  7. linux 下后台运行python脚本

    1.运行python脚本命令 nohup python -u pix2pix.py > out.log 2>&1 & 2.查看正在输出的日志(动态打印): tail -f ...

  8. 下怎么运行sh脚本_基于CentOS7系统添加自定义脚本服务及参数说明,附实例

    概述 centos6如果要添加自定义脚本服务只需要把脚本放到/etc/init.d然后授权后用chkconfig添加后就可以管理了,那么centos7又是怎么添加自定义脚本服务呢? CentOS7添加 ...

  9. linux使得python后台运行,linux 下后台运行python脚本

    &符号 这两天要在服务器端一直运行一个Python脚本,当然就想到了在命令后面加&符号 $ python /data/python/server.py >python.log & ...

最新文章

  1. python之禅 中文_《Python之禅》中对于Python编程过程中的一些建议
  2. Maven的个性化定制
  3. leetcode 646. Maximum Length of Pair Chain | 646. 最长数对链(暴力递归->傻缓存->dp)
  4. java semaphore 等待_Java并发编程系列之Semaphore详解
  5. FYFG的完整形式是什么?
  6. 什么是语义化的HTML?有何意义?为什么要做到语义化?
  7. PMP备考之路 - 汪博士第六章(项目进度管理)
  8. php phalapi,[6.3]-SDK包(PHP版) | PhalApi(π框架) - PHP轻量级开源接口框架 - 接口,从简单开始!...
  9. Kafka之sync、async以及oneway
  10. 『关键词挖掘』结合 LDA + Word2Vec + TextRank 实现关键词的挖掘
  11. 普通人职场自我反省十条
  12. dreamweaver网页设计作业制作 (NBA篮球网页设计与制作) HTML+CSS
  13. Oracle生成日历表
  14. 9.7. Pattern Matching
  15. 实战|用 Python 轻松制作好看的心型照片墙
  16. 收藏 外贸企业必备的跨境电商B2B出口报关完整指南
  17. 【互联网品读】程序员被骗婚,结婚一月后被离婚,不给财产起诉
  18. 利用数学公式计算点到线的距离
  19. 山东大学软件学院项目实训-创新实训-网络安全靶场实验平台(一)
  20. [NTT][DP][树链剖分][分治] LOJ #6289. 花朵

热门文章

  1. Ip是什么?指纹浏览器可以使用代理ip吗?
  2. U盘的工作原理(读取和存储数据)
  3. Elasticsearch 中的“生产模式”和“开发模式”是什么
  4. 服装行业如何实现数字化生产模式
  5. 案例:Nginx作为Web缓存服务器应用
  6. ItemCF的演进:狭义 VS 广义
  7. 词云制作(中文分词+英文)
  8. linux xargs cp,Linux xargs命令的使用
  9. 如何使用Python构建自己的MuZero AI
  10. 数据库 模式 视图 索引